About the Panel Discussion
In this engaging panel discussion on Maximizing Human Capital: Strategies for a Thriving Workplace, expert speakers will explore key topics on enhancing human capital, workplace issues, employment engagement and talent management.
Who Should Attend
This online panel discussion is open to anyone interested in creating better workplaces. Whether you are part of a team, leading one, or simply passionate about people and performance, you’ll gain valuable insights on building a thriving, engaged, and future-ready workforce.

Daw Kyawt Kay Thi Win, Country Director, Business Consolidation for Gender Equality Association (BCGE) Daw Kyawt Kay Thi Win is a management professional with more than eighteen years of progressive experience in the development, public and private sectors. Having worked in various senior management roles in local and international organisations, she has led the Business Coalition for Gender Equality Association as Country Director since its foundation in 2018. She has developed a sustainable business model of workplace gender equality, which guides organisations in developing a clear vision of their diversity, equity and inclusion journey towards sustainable business. The Know Your WGE Assessment Kyawt Kay Thi Win established is the first workplace gender equality assessment in the country, which guides organisations to understand the opportunities, strengths, gaps and areas to improve in fostering equitable and inclusive workplaces. She is a thought leader and a strong advocate of DEI, defining the association as the centre of excellence and a trusted advisor on unconscious bias, social and cultural norms, stereotypes, workplace gender equality, diversity and inclusion in Myanmar. Kyawt Kay Thi Win has become a strong voice for the business sector agenda on DEI, winning the Women Icons Network’s Asia D&I Champion Award 2022. She is the president of the ASEAN Human Development Organisation, Myanmar Chapter, and sits on the Advisory Board of Myanmar Sustainable Business Network.

Daw Maw Maw Tun, Founder and Managing Director, Top HR Solutions Co., Ltd.
Daw Maw Maw Tun stands as a preeminent figure in the realm of HR, renowned for her profound expertise in strategic HR practices and an astute comprehension of Myanmar’s intricate market dynamics. With over 15 years of diverse experience across international organizations, including diplomatic roles and over 5 years as Director of Administration and HR Management in the private sector, her meticulous HR policies have empowered business and led to the establishment of TOP HR Solutions in 2014 and started providing HR services to many local and international organizations. In 2015, she founded Myanmar Career Bridge Academy (MCBA), empowering thousands with job-ready skills for socio-economic sustainability. Her published works on Labour Laws in 2019 are testament to her impact as an HR practitioner and entrepreneur. Until now, Ms. Maw Maw Tun’s and TOP HR team has serviced 180+ organizations in Myanmar, graduating 6000+ individuals from MCBA. Her visionary initiatives exemplify a transformative legacy in Myanmar’s HR landscape. In addition, Daw Maw Maw Tun is Executive Committee Member of Myanmar Women Entrepreneurs’ Association (MWEA), Executive Committee Member (Auditor) of Myanmar Private TVET Association (MPTA), Executive Committee Member (Auditor) of Local Employment Companies Association (LECA), Member of The Union of Myanmar Federation of Chambers of Commerce and Industry (UMFCCI), Member of College of Myanmar Arbitrators (Myanmar Arbitration Center) and Member of Myanmar Institute of Directors (MIoD).

Daw Wah Wah Min, Managing Director, Kaung Lin Khant Co., Ltd.
Daw Wah Wah Min is a founder and a Managing Director of Skills for Success Recruitment and Human Resource Service. she has about a decade of experience in training and social enterprise consulting, working with organizations such as the British Council Myanmar and the ILO. She is a Central Executive Committee member of Myanmar Women Entrepreneurs Association (MWEA), taking charge of the Responsible Business Committee. She won the Myanmar Women Entrepreneurs Award from MWEA and ASEAN Women Entrepreneurs Award from ASEAN Women Entrepreneurs Association. Wah Wah holds an LL.B and MBA from Yangon Institute of Economics and attended Director Certification Program from Thai IOD, Audit Committee Master Program from IFC, International Labour Standards and Corporate Responsibilities Training from International Training Centre of ILO (Turin), Human Resource Management and Industrial Relations from AOTS, Japan and Active Citizens Master Facilitators Program from the British Council in England. |

The eleventh instalment of the Leadership series was delivered by the well-known and well-respected Prof. Dr. Aung Tun Thet on the topic of “AI augmented Leadership” on 18 March 2025.
A huge thanks to our speaker for presenting insightful knowledge focusing how AI is transforming leadership by enhancing decision-making, innovation, and personalization. As a co-pilot, AI empowers leaders to focus on vision, strategy, and team growth. The future lies in blending human intuition with AI-driven insights for smarter, more adaptive leadership.
